Cillian Murphy: The Mastermind, Thomas Shelby
When you think of "Peaky Blinders," Cillian Murphy as Thomas Shelby probably comes to mind first. He's the very core of the show, isn't he? His portrayal of the intense, calculating, and somewhat haunted gang leader is absolutely captivating. Murphy manages to show us a character who is both utterly ruthless and, in a way, deeply vulnerable. It’s a pretty complex mix, that.
His eyes alone seem to tell a whole story, you know, of ambition, pain, and a constant internal struggle. Murphy’s quiet intensity and his ability to convey so much with just a look are, frankly, a huge reason why Tommy Shelby has become such an iconic figure in television history. He really embodies the character, honestly.
Before stepping into Tommy's shoes, Murphy had already built a pretty impressive filmography. He's worked a lot with director Christopher Nolan, appearing in films like "Batman Begins" as Scarecrow, "Inception," and "Dunkirk." He also starred in the zombie thriller "28 Days Later." These roles, you might say, showed his incredible range and his knack for picking out interesting, often challenging, characters. He's got a real knack for it, as a matter of fact.
Biography and Personal Details
Detail | Information |
---|---|
Full Name | Cillian Murphy |
Date of Birth | May 25, 1976 |
Place of Birth | Douglas, County Cork, Ireland |
Nationality | Irish |
Occupation | Actor |
Spouse | Yvonne McGuinness |
Children | 2 |
Notable Roles (Other) | Scarecrow (Batman Begins), Robert Fischer (Inception), Jim (28 Days Later), J. Robert Oppenheimer (Oppenheimer) |

Helen McCrory: The Matriarch, Polly Gray
Helen McCrory, who sadly passed away in 2021, left an absolutely indelible mark as Aunt Polly Gray. She was the matriarch, the strong, wise, and fiercely protective backbone of the Shelby family. Polly was, in a way, the moral compass, or at least tried to be, while also being capable of incredible ruthlessness when her family was threatened. Her presence was, quite frankly, magnetic.
McCrory’s portrayal of Polly was full of grace, strength, and a deep understanding of the character’s complex layers. She commanded every scene she was in, often with just a look or a subtle gesture. Her performance was a masterclass in portraying a woman who had seen it all and was still standing tall. It was truly something special to watch, you know?
Beyond "Peaky Blinders," McCrory had a really distinguished career across film, television, and theatre. She was Narcissa Malfoy in the "Harry Potter" films, and she appeared in "Skyfall" and "The Queen." Her passing was a huge loss to the acting world, and her legacy as Polly Gray remains a powerful part of the series. Her impact is still felt, as a matter of fact.
Tom Hardy: The Unpredictable Force, Alfie Solomons
Tom Hardy as Alfie Solomons, the eccentric and unpredictable Jewish gang leader, is, quite frankly, a scene-stealer. Every time he appears on screen, the energy shifts, and you're just on the edge of your seat, wondering what he’ll do or say next. Hardy brings a really unique blend of menace, humor, and a strange sort of charm to Alfie. It's truly a performance that stands out.
His distinctive voice, his mannerisms, and his sheer presence make Alfie an unforgettable character, even though he's not a main member of the Shelby family. Hardy’s ability to create such a memorable character with relatively limited screen time is a testament to his incredible talent and his knack for making every role his own. He's really quite good at it, you know?
Hardy is, of course, a widely recognized actor with a very impressive body of work. He's known for roles in "The Dark Knight Rises" as Bane, "Mad Max: Fury Road," "Inception," and "Venom." His inclusion in the "Peaky Blinders" cast just added another layer of star power and, in a way, elevated the show even further. He's a big draw, for sure.
Sophie Rundle: The Modern Woman, Ada Thorne
Ada Thorne, née Shelby, played by Sophie Rundle, is the only sister among the Shelby brothers, and she really represents a different kind of strength. She often tries to distance herself from the family's criminal dealings, seeking a more conventional life, but she's always drawn back in. Rundle portrays Ada with a quiet resilience and a sharp intelligence. She's pretty independent, that's for sure.
Her character's journey is a fascinating one, as she navigates love, loss, and her evolving place within the powerful Shelby clan. Rundle brings a very believable depth to Ada, showing her struggles and her moments of courage. She's, in a way, the heart of the family that tries to stay true to itself amidst all the chaos. You can really feel her convictions, can't you?
Sophie Rundle has also starred in other popular British dramas, including "Gentleman Jack" and "The Nest," showing her versatility as an actress. Her work on "Peaky Blinders" has certainly helped to raise her profile, allowing audiences to see her talent in a really compelling role. She's got a good track record, you know.
Finn Cole: The Rising Ambition, Michael Gray
Michael Gray, Polly’s son, played by Finn Cole, starts off as a somewhat innocent, sheltered young man who is brought into the Shelby fold. However, he quickly becomes a very ambitious and, in a way, increasingly ruthless figure within the family business. Cole captures Michael's transformation from a naive boy to a calculating operator really well. It's quite a shift, honestly.
His journey is marked by a growing conflict with Tommy, as Michael believes he can modernize the family's operations and, in some respects, take over. Cole portrays this ambition and the underlying tension with a cool, measured performance. He's definitely one to watch, you know, as his character develops.
Finn Cole is also known for his role in the American crime drama "Animal Kingdom," where he plays Joshua "J" Cody. His work on both "Peaky Blinders" and "Animal Kingdom" shows his ability to portray complex characters in intense family dynamics. He's got a pretty good handle on those sorts of roles, as a matter of fact.
Anya Taylor-Joy: The American Intrigue, Gina Gray
Anya Taylor-Joy joined the cast as Gina Gray, Michael's ambitious American wife, and she brought a whole new layer of intrigue to the series. Gina is a very strong-willed and manipulative character who has her own plans for Michael and the Shelby company. Taylor-Joy's portrayal is, quite frankly, captivating and, in a way, a bit unsettling. She's got a real presence.
Her character's mysterious background and her influence on Michael add a fresh dynamic to the later seasons. Taylor-Joy embodies Gina's cunning and her desire for power with a cool, sharp performance that really stands out. She's a formidable addition to the cast, that's for sure.
Anya Taylor-Joy has become a huge star in recent years, especially after her breakout role in "The Queen's Gambit." She's also appeared in films like "The Witch," "Split," and "Emma." Her talent is undeniable, and her presence in "Peaky Blinders" only added to the show's already stellar ensemble. She's very much in demand, you know.
